Step 1: Understand Search Intent
Before you open any keyword tool, you need to understand what your clients are actually looking for.
There are three main types of search intent:
-
Informational – e.g., “how to book an escort safely”
-
Navigational – e.g., “Elite Escorts London” (a brand search)
-
Transactional – e.g., “VIP escorts in Birmingham”
For escort agency SEO services, transactional keywords are usually the most profitable because they target clients who are ready to book.
Step 2: Use Multiple Keyword Tools
Mainstream keyword tools like Ahrefs, SEMrush, and Ubersuggest can help, but they often filter adult terms. To work around this:
-
Use a mix of keyword tools for cross-referencing.
-
Manually check Google’s auto-suggest for location-specific terms.
-
Look at escort directory listings to see what keywords competitors are using.

Step 9: Place Keywords Strategically
Keyword placement matters just as much as keyword choice.
-
Put your main keyword in the page title, H1 tag, and URL.
-
Include it naturally in the first 100 words.
-
Use variations in headings and throughout the body text.
